To solve the question regarding the reaction of cyclohexanone when heated with sodium hydroxide solution, we can follow these steps: ### Step-by-Step Solution: 1. **Identify the Reactants**: - The reactant is cyclohexanone, which has the structure of a six-membered ring with a carbonyl group (C=O) attached to one of the carbon atoms. 2. **Understand the Role of Sodium Hydroxide (NaOH)**: - Sodium hydroxide is a strong base and can abstract protons (H⁺) from compounds. In this case, it will abstract an alpha-hydrogen from cyclohexanone. 3. **Identify Alpha-Hydrogens**: - Cyclohexanone has two alpha-hydrogens on the carbon atoms adjacent to the carbonyl carbon. These hydrogens are acidic and can be removed by the base. 4. **Aldol Condensation Mechanism**: - The reaction of cyclohexanone with NaOH leads to an aldol condensation. The base abstracts an alpha-hydrogen, forming an enolate ion. This enolate can then attack the carbonyl carbon of another cyclohexanone molecule. 5. **Formation of Beta-Hydroxy Carbonyl Compound**: - The nucleophilic attack results in the formation of a beta-hydroxy carbonyl compound (an aldol). This compound has both a hydroxyl group (-OH) and a carbonyl group (C=O) in its structure. 6. **Dehydration to Form Alpha, Beta-Unsaturated Carbonyl Compound**: - Upon heating, the beta-hydroxy carbonyl compound undergoes dehydration (loss of water) to form an alpha, beta-unsaturated carbonyl compound. This compound has a double bond between the alpha and beta carbons. 7. **Final Product**: - The final product of the reaction is an alpha, beta-unsaturated carbonyl compound derived from cyclohexanone. ### Conclusion: The product formed when cyclohexanone is heated with sodium hydroxide solution is an **alpha, beta-unsaturated carbonyl compound**.
